NEWS FEED & ADDITIVE MAGAZINE February 2023 85 Compana Pet Brands, global leader in pet care and nutrition, announced it has appointed Greg Pearson as Chief Executive Officer, effective Jan. 1, 2023. Pearson succeeds John Howe, who will transition to a new role as senior advisor for the company. Pearson is a seasoned and proven executive with deep experience leading and transforming consumer businesses. Most recently, he served as CEO of Pretzels, Inc., a rapidly growing private label and contract manufacturer of pretzels in the United States, where he led a variety of transformational growth and operational initiatives. During his tenure, Pretzels, Inc. scaled its supply chain by opening a third manufacturing facility, which created over 300 new manufacturing jobs and invested heavily in new product development, introducing several products to the market. These investments in production capacity and innovation capabilities ultimately led to the successful sale of Pretzels, Inc. to The Hershey Company in 2021. Read more>> Cargill completes acquisition of Owensboro Grain Company The BC Salmon Farmers Association (BCSFA) announces the appointment of Brian Kingzett, as the new Executive Director of the BC Salmon Farmers Association. Brian has 35 years of experience in the environmental and aquaculture sectors where he has amassed a unique blend of professional expertise locally and abroad.
